The update introduces several improvements to the voice chat, notifications of goals and adds links to gaming hub in different areas of the Xbox One interface; I am not now including dedicated server for voice chat and send voice messages, because Micosoft wants to test some more with the community in preview before releasing them at all. Here is the complete list of news, followed by a video that shows.
- Group chat enhancements – The party chat was improved with a series of indicators that tell us if your microphone is muted and warn us if your privacy settings or network problems prevent us from communicating with specific members of the party.
- Links to gaming hub – users can now reach more easily the game's hub since activity feeds; for example, in posts of friends concerning the release of goals or posting videos and screenshots, there will now be a link to the hub of the game for the post. The app also the objectives you've placed the link to the hub of the game shows.
- Target Notifications – notifications Now unblocked objectives also show the description, eliminating the need to open the app objectives. If you decide to open the app from a notification, it will open faster.
